System Reliability Summary

System Reliability by K.B. Klassen

This text aims to familiarize the reader with the principles and terminology of reliability engineering which has become a subject of great importance. It looks at methods for improving reliability and the approaches of deterministic and statistical reliability engineering are explained in such a way that the practical implications of the equations become clear. Methods of handling the reliability of large and complex systems are discussed, and a chapter is devoted to software reliability. Problems with full solutions are provided. The book is intended for advanced undergraduate and postgraduate students of mechanical, production, aero and electrical/electronic engineering.

Table of Contents

Part 1 Deterministic reliability: Arrhenius' model; failure mechanisms; screening. Part 2 Statistical reliability: nomenclature; operational reliability quantities. Part 3 Statistical failure of components: failure distributions - negative-exponential, normal, lognormal, Weibull and gamma distribution; life distribution measurements. Part 4 Reliability models: catastrophic failure model; stress-strength model; Markov model. Part 5 Non-maintained systems: series systems; redundancy; parallel systems; "m-out-of-n" systems; majority voting systems; mixed systems; optimization; analysis methods. Part 6 Maintained systems: systems with preventive maintenance - scheduled and condition-based; systems with corrective maintenance - with and without redundancy, shared-repair facilities, inhomogenous systems; maintenance aspects. Part 7 Evaluation methods: causal evaluation - FMEC analysis; anti-causal evaluation - fault-tree analysis; risk and safety. Part 8 Reliability of computer software: writing reliable software; reliability testing; failure model. Solutions to problems. Appendices: applied Laplace transforms; the Central Limit theorem; most commonly used symbols.
